Marriott warns consumers of phone scam offering free hotel stay

If you get a call from someone claiming to a offer free stay at a Marriott hotel, hang up.

Marriott International has released a statement warning consumers of fraudulent phone calls being made in different parts of the world, where the caller offers a complimentary stay at a Marriott hotel in exchange for personal information, or the purchase of a product or service unrelated to the Marriott brand.

"If you receive a suspicious telephone call, especially for a contest you did not enter, we urge you not to provide any personal information, especially credit card information," says Marriott.

"Instead, simply end the phone call."
